Description

At 8:20 p.m. MDT, Environment Canada meteorologists are tracking a severe thunderstorm capable of producing very strong wind gusts, up to toonie size hail and heavy rain. This thunderstorm is located between Drumheller and Hanna, and is heading to the northeast at 60 km/h. ### Severe thunderstorm warnings are issued when imminent or occurring thunderstorms are expected to produce damaging hail, wind or rain.

Instruction

Take immediate cover if a thunderstorm approaches. If outside, protect yourself from flying debris and hail.
